摘要
We investigate the dependence of large-angular-scale cosmic microwave background anisotropies on various initial conditions, including both adiabatic and isocurvature perturbations and the initial power-law index n, in a variety of low-OMEGA cosmological models. LAMBDA-dominated flat models, inflationary open adiabatic models, with n(eff) < 1, and open isocurvature models, with n(eff) congruent-to 2, are significantly constrained.
